Common plastering services in Hampstead

Re-skimming
Applying a fresh skim coat over existing walls or ceilings. Creates a smooth, paint-ready surface — the most common plastering job.
Full replaster
Hacking off old plaster and replastering from scratch. Used when existing plaster is blown, damp-damaged, or has failed.
Plasterboarding
Fixing plasterboard to stud frames or masonry and skimming to a finish. Standard in extensions, loft conversions and new builds.
External rendering
Applying sand-and-cement, silicone or monocouche render to external walls. Pebble dash removal and re-render also available.
Artex removal
Removing or boarding over textured Artex ceilings — with asbestos testing and appropriate treatment if required.
Coving & cornicing
Installing coving or restoring original period cornicing. Mixes of plaster and polyurethane profiles available.
Damp plaster repair
Hacking off damp-affected plaster, treating the source, and replastering with salt-resistant render or standard finish.
Venetian plaster
Specialist polished and decorative plaster finishes for feature walls, hallways and high-specification interiors.

Victorian and Edwardian properties throughout Hampstead commonly experience cracking due to minor structural settlement and age-related movement, requiring skilled plasterers experienced in period-appropriate repairs and lime plaster compatibility. Contemporary homes in NW3 developments may suffer from damp-related plaster deterioration or inadequate drying after construction, issues that local plasterers are well-equipped to diagnose and remediate.

For Hampstead's period properties, patch repairs are often preferable when damage is localised, preserving original plasterwork and maintaining character; however, when cracks are widespread or structural movement is evident, full replastering becomes necessary to ensure long-term stability. Modern Hampstead homes may benefit from full replastering if existing surfaces show general wear, whereas Victorian properties typically warrant careful assessment to determine whether selective patching can extend the life of original finishes.
